2014 Orlando selected Dario Saric (pick 12) ahead of Zach LaVine (pick 13) and then traded Saric on draft night to move up two spots for Elfrid Payton. Zach LaVine went on to make two NBA All-Star appearances and Payton has been a journeyman (he's played for 5 NBA teams but hasn't been seen in the NBA since 2021-22)
